HOW IT WORKS

A small display ad, or an inexpensive classified ad is placed in
daily or weekly newspapers inviting the reader to call a recorded
message for more free information on your product, service or
event. Using a well-written, benefit-rich script, you, or a
professional speaker, record a 2 or 3 minute message that entices
the caller to do one of the following:

(1) Leave his/her name and address and request that the order be
shipped C.O.D.

(2) Leave his/her name and address to request more "free
information" be sent.

A third method that some have tired concerns credit card
ordering. however, most operators have found that this does not
work very well. people do not like to leave their charge card
number at the end of a recorded message. A fourth method that has
had some success, asks the caller to order direct from the phone
message, by sending a check or money order. Which of the two
primary options works best? There are several advocates of each
method.

Obviously, if you are offering a high-ticket item, or a
specialized service (real estate, insurance, multi-level
marketing, etc...) you would want simply to capture the callers
address and/or phone number for the follow-up.

If you're selling a relatively low-priced item (less than $50),
such as a book, gift item, etc., you can either use the C.O.D or
inquiry method.

To ship C.O.D., or not, is a marketing option that confronts
every marketer who has a reasonably priced item, and who wants to
use a recorded message as a selling tool.

The major advantage of C.O.D. shipping is that the order
instructions are captured on your answering machine, and can be
processed and shipped immediately.

The major disadvantage to the C.O.D. method is that it is likely
that 40% to 55% of all orders shipped will come back to you
because the UPS driver or U.S. Postal Route Carrier (C.O.D.
orders can be shipped either by United Parcel Service or by U.S.
Mail) could not make delivery and get paid. that's not good!

Proponents of C.O.D. shipping claim, even with the huge amount of
undeliverable, that this method is still their favorite. There
are three entrepreneurs, one in Utah, one in California, another
in Arizona, who each are making millions of dollars per year
selling books and reports, via the C.O.D method. it's nice to
keep it simple. you run your ads, you use a hard sell recorded
telephone script. the callers leave their address, and you ship.

Marketers who hate C.O.D. shipping usually can't emotionally
handle all those undeliverable, unpaid for shipments. C.O.D.
shipping does work for some. if you can "psychologically" handle
the big return factor, it may make you the kind of money you have
always dreamed of making.

Another option to the C.O.D. method is the two-step inquiry
method. Sure, it's much slower. First you capture the name and
address of the voice responder. Next you rush him or her (it's
wise to mail within 48 hours--or less!) your sales literature. no
huge ego-deflating returns, plus your printed sales literature
can make a much stronger, and longer presentation than a 2 or 3
minute electronic script.

WHY IT WORKS

Why does a simple answering machine work so well. We have
discovered that many people who are usually not "mail responsive"
will pick up a telephone and call a recorded message. this is
particularly true of newspaper readers.

HOW TO OBTAIN A MERCHANT'S CREDIT CARD ACCOUNT



It's a proven fact that mail order marketers can increase sales
substantially by offering their customers a credit card option.

Some marketers enjoy increases of 10% to 30% in sales when they
get up with a Visa/Mastercard merchants account. Others have
reported increases up to a whopping 100%, or even more!

If all of your sales are made by mail, you can expect to up your
total sales by at least 10%, and more likely 15% to 30% simply by
offering the credit card option. If you plan to use the telephone
a great deal as a marketing tool, offering a credit card buying
option could double or triple your sales.

Credit card buying is seductive. Many people like the option of
buying something today that they won't have to pay for until
later. Also, most consumers tend to spend more using their
plastic, than when they're writing a check, or paying cash.

REASONS WHY YOU SHOULD BECOME A CREDIT CARD MERCHANT

There are many good reasons why you can benefit from securing
credit card merchants status. Here are some of them...

* People with credit cards are more affluent than those without
plastic. They can afford to spend more money.
* They tend to be better "credit risks", if you want to sell
"open account."

* Overall, they buy more by mail than those without cards.

* You cannot effectively sell from commercials on radio or TV
without offering credit card purchasing. Visa and Mastercard are
by far, the cards most consumers have.

* They often will make credit card purchases even when they are
short on cash, and/or when their checking account balance is low.

* You can sell on installments, obtaining permission to charge
the buyer's card on a monthly basis.

* You can ship goods with the secure knowledge that payment has
been secured before shipment is made.
